The study focuses on the role of the peptide BPC 157 in healing and its comparison to standard angiogenic growth factors such as EGF, FGF, and VEGF. Key findings include:

  1. Healing Efficacy Across Tissues: BPC 157 demonstrated consistent effectiveness in healing acute and chronic injuries across the gastrointestinal (GI) tract (esophagus, stomach, duodenum, and lower GI) and extragastrointestinal tissues (tendons, ligaments, muscles, and bones). This was observed irrespective of the administration method (intraperitoneal, oral, or local).

  2. Unique Properties of BPC 157: Unlike the standard growth factors, BPC 157 consistently improved healing across different tissue types using similar regimens as those used for GI healing. It appears to have a unique angiogenic effect that supports its broad healing capabilities.

  3. Broader Implications: The study suggests that BPC 157 uniquely fulfills a pharmacological and pathophysiological role in healing, effectively integrating the benefits of multiple angiogenic growth factors in both GI and musculoskeletal repair

The findings position BPC 157 as a promising therapeutic agent with broad applicability for tissue repair and healing.
